Know before you go
Hi, I'm Eve. Here are a few practical things to know before exploring Soho Square.
- Visit during weekdays for a quieter experience, as weekends can get quite busy with locals and tourists.
- Bring a picnic to enjoy on the lawns, especially during warm, sunny days.
- Check local event listings to catch live performances or activities happening in the square.
